Došnica

The 883rd longest river in the world

km

The Došnica river is a river in North Macedonia. It is a right tributary to the Crna Reka between Tikveš plain and the Vardar. It springs from Koprišnica Falls and Mount Kožuf. A hydroelectric power plant is located on the river at Čiflik, Demir Kapija.

Flows through: North Macedonia.
